PublicApiGenerator 6.1.0-beta2

This is a prerelease version of PublicApiGenerator.
There is a newer version of this package available.
See the version list below for details.
dotnet add package PublicApiGenerator --version 6.1.0-beta2                
NuGet\Install-Package PublicApiGenerator -Version 6.1.0-beta2                
This command is intended to be used within the Package Manager Console in Visual Studio, as it uses the NuGet module's version of Install-Package.
<PackageReference Include="PublicApiGenerator" Version="6.1.0-beta2" />                
For projects that support PackageReference, copy this XML node into the project file to reference the package.
paket add PublicApiGenerator --version 6.1.0-beta2                
#r "nuget: PublicApiGenerator, 6.1.0-beta2"                
#r directive can be used in F# Interactive and Polyglot Notebooks. Copy this into the interactive tool or source code of the script to reference the package.
// Install PublicApiGenerator as a Cake Addin
#addin nuget:?package=PublicApiGenerator&version=6.1.0-beta2&prerelease

// Install PublicApiGenerator as a Cake Tool
#tool nuget:?package=PublicApiGenerator&version=6.1.0-beta2&prerelease                

This library simply returns your public API as a string. You can use this in approval style tests or for documentation

There are no supported framework assets in this package.

Learn more about Target Frameworks and .NET Standard.

NuGet packages (1)

Showing the top 1 NuGet packages that depend on PublicApiGenerator:

Package Downloads
ApiApprover

Simply add this package to add a test which generates a string of your public API, then sends it to Approval Tests to approve any public API changes. Don't accidently miss a breaking API change and break semantic versioning again.

GitHub repositories (59)

Showing the top 5 popular GitHub repositories that depend on PublicApiGenerator:

Repository Stars
Humanizr/Humanizer
Humanizer meets all your .NET needs for manipulating and displaying strings, enums, dates, times, timespans, numbers and quantities
reactiveui/refit
The automatic type-safe REST library for .NET Core, Xamarin and .NET. Heavily inspired by Square's Retrofit library, Refit turns your REST API into a live interface.
reactiveui/ReactiveUI
An advanced, composable, functional reactive model-view-viewmodel framework for all .NET platforms that is inspired by functional reactive programming. ReactiveUI allows you to abstract mutable state away from your user interfaces, express the idea around a feature in one readable place and improve the testability of your application.
serilog/serilog
Simple .NET logging with fully-structured events
dotnet/reactive
The Reactive Extensions for .NET
Version Downloads Last updated
11.3.0 9,818 12/17/2024
11.2.0 10,292 12/11/2024
11.1.0 435,485 12/3/2023
11.0.0 223,615 3/6/2023
10.5.0 482 3/6/2023
10.4.1 291 3/6/2023
10.4.0 297 3/6/2023
10.3.0 259,549 1/31/2022
10.2.0 629,821 6/26/2020
10.1.2 7,446 6/18/2020
10.1.1 759 6/17/2020
10.1.0 4,425 5/18/2020
10.0.2 96,236 1/27/2020
10.0.1 131,041 12/4/2019
10.0.0 1,314 12/1/2019
9.3.0 210,356 8/2/2019
9.2.0 1,671 8/2/2019
9.1.0 13,142 6/30/2019
9.0.0 2,515 6/13/2019
9.0.0-beta3 1,389 3/31/2019
9.0.0-beta2 1,379 3/29/2019
9.0.0-beta1 1,210 3/29/2019
8.1.0 48,727 1/7/2019
8.0.1 7,286 9/23/2018
8.0.0 2,426 7/24/2018
7.1.0 1,611 7/18/2018
7.0.1 4,874 5/7/2018
7.0.0 1,514 3/10/2018
6.6.0 1,353 3/9/2018
6.5.2 1,116 3/8/2018
6.5.1 1,208 3/7/2018
6.5.0 3,744 11/17/2017
6.4.0 2,835 10/10/2017
6.1.0-beta2 3,076 5/22/2017
6.1.0-beta1 2,786 5/15/2017
6.0.0 12,052 12/14/2016
5.0.0 4,146 11/21/2016
4.2.0 3,660 11/2/2016
4.1.0 3,255 10/6/2016
4.0.1 16,433 2/2/2016
4.0.0 1,721 2/2/2016

v6.1 Changes:    
     - Support for content files in nuspec
     - Bump of Mono.Cecil dependency
     v6.0 Breaking changes:
     - The async keyword doesn't influence the public API and therefore is no longer treated as part of the public API.
     v5.0 Breaking changes:
     - Converted to source only package
     - Invariant Culture used for string.Format
     - Custom attributes are properly taken into account for set methods